Morphology and Identification

Barbula pflanzii is a small, acrocarpous moss that forms dense, cushion-like tufts or mats. Its leaves are lanceolate to ovate-lanceolate, with a distinctive costa (midrib) that extends beyond the leaf apex, forming a short hair point. The leaf margins are often recurved, and the cells are papillose, giving the leaves a rough texture.

One of the most striking features of Barbula pflanzii is its twisted peristome teeth, which are hygroscopic, meaning they move in response to changes in humidity. This adaptation aids in the dispersal of spores, ensuring the continuation of the species.

Ecological Roles and Adaptations

Despite its small size, Barbula pflanzii plays a significant role in its ecosystems. As a pioneer species, it contributes to soil formation and stabilization, paving the way for other plants to establish themselves. Additionally, its ability to retain moisture and provide shelter for microorganisms and invertebrates makes it an essential component of many terrestrial ecosystems.
One of the remarkable adaptations of Barbula pflanzii is its tolerance to desiccation. During dry periods, the moss can enter a state of dormancy, curling up its leaves to minimize water loss. When moisture returns, it quickly revives, demonstrating its remarkable resilience in harsh environments.
